Phytogenic-mediated silver nanoparticles using Persicaria hydropiper extracts and its catalytic activity against multidrug resistant bacteria
Multidrug resistance (MDR) is one of the major global threats of this century. So new innovative approaches are needed for the development of existing antibiotics to limit antibacterial resistance.
